Merchant Acceptance Standard and Registration Specification of JD.HK Open Platform

Chapter I    Overview

JD.HK Open Platform leads the new fashion of cross-border consumption to continuously introduce reassuring global merchants and high-quality products for Chinese high-end consumers. We are now recruiting overseas as well as Hong Kong, Macao and Taiwan merchants around the world.

Chapter II   Merchant Acceptance Requirements of JD.HK Open Platform

2.1 Basic conditions for merchant acceptance

2.1.1     Have a corporate entity registered overseas or in Hong Kong, Macao or Taiwan.

2.1.2     The store operator shall have the subject of joint and several liability (namely domestic agent) in mainland China.

2.1.3     Have an overseas or Hong Kong, Macao or Taiwan corporate bank account (settled in USD).

2.1.4     Priority has been given to recruit overseas as well as Hong Kong, Macao and Taiwan well-known physical marketplaces or B2C websites, brand owners, brand agents, well-known retailers and well-known brands that have not entered the Chinese market.

Chapter III Requirements of JD.HK Open Platform for Store Type and Brand Qualification

3.1 Type of store

The stores can be dived into brand flagship store, marketplace flagship store, exclusive store and franchise store.

3.1.1     Brand flagship store

3.1.1.1  Direct-sale brand flagship store

It refers to the flagship store directly operated by the brand owner (trademark right holder) with one or more private brands. If more than one private brand is operated, all the brands shall be owned by the same actual controller.

3.1.1.2  Authorized brand flagship store

It refers to the flagship store where a registered company has the Level-1 authorization of the brand owner (trademark right holder) and operates one or more authorized brands. If more than one brand is operated, all the brands shall be owned by the same actual controller.

3.1.2     Marketplace flagship store

It refers to the marketplace flagship store of service trademark (namely Class-35 trademark)-owned online or offline retailer in overseas or Hong Kong, Macao or Taiwan.

3.1.3     Franchise store

It refers to the store operating one or more authorized brands, for which the brand or trademark right holder provides a store operating authorization for registration on JD.HK. If more than one authorized brand is operated, all the brands shall be owned by the same actual controller.

3.1.4     Exclusive store

It refers to the store that operates two or more of private or authorized brands.

Chapter IV Specification for Merchant Registration on JD.HK Open Platform

4.1.       Registration instructions

4.1.1     JD.HK Open Platform has not authorized any agency to conduct merchant acceptance service for the time being. The registration application process and relevant charge notes shall be subject to the official merchant acceptance page of JD.HK Open Platform.

4.1.2     JD.HK Open Platform is entitled to require sellers to provide other qualifications in registration application and subsequent operation stages.

4.1.3     JD.HK Open Platform will update this standard from time to time in combination with the development trends of various industries, relevant national regulations and consumers' purchase demands.

4.1.4     Sellers must truthfully provide materials and information: Please be sure to ensure the authenticity, integrity, and effectiveness of the relevant qualifications and information provided in the application and subsequent business stages (if the relevant qualifications provided by Sellers are provided by third parties, including but not limited to trademark registration certificate, power of attorney, etc., please verify the authenticity, validity, and integrity of the documents first). In case of any false qualification or information, JD.HK Open Platform will no longer cooperate with the Seller and is entitled to deal with it according to the rules of JD.HK Open Platform and relevant agreements signed with the Seller.

4.1.5     Requirements for commodities and services

4.1.5.1  Commodity: It should be original or sold overseas or in Hong Kong, Macao and Taiwan of China, with 100% original quality guaranteed. Only commodities delivered by direct mail or free trade zone can be sold.

4.1.5.2  Commodity page: The page information shall be described in Chinese, international public system unit of measurement, with Chinese customer service (Dongdong customer service).

4.1.5.3  Online service: Provide Chinese Dongdong customer service staff, download and install Dongdong software, and answer questions from customers.

4.1.5.4  Logistics service: The delivery shall be completed within 72 hours after the customer placed the order, and the logistics information can be traced.  At the same time, merchants must sign the Cross-border Logistics Platform Service Agreement, and use JD Logistics to deliver commodities and all orders that are imported in the mode of cross-border declaration.

4.1.5.5  Customer service: There shall be a return service station, contact person, and contact information in the Chinese mainland.

4.2 Merchant registration

4.2.1     User name registration and management

JD.HK Open Platform will register user names for the merchant in ERP background, called "merchant user name", upon the merchant and JD.HK Open Platform signed a cooperation agreement. The store name shall follow the Naming Rules for Merchant Stores of JD.HK Open Platform, and the relevant personnel of JD.HK Open Platform will inform the merchant of the user name and password with written documents. The user name shall not be changed without authorization, and the merchant shall change the password and keep it properly. The merchant shall keep the security of the user name and password information properly, and the user name shall not be transferred or authorized to be used by others in any form. In addition, the merchant shall be fully responsible for all activities carried out under the user name and password.

4.2.2     Commodity release

All merchants shall release commodity information on the JD.HK Open Platform in strict accordance with the Rules. However, they shall not publish lawless or illegal commodity information. All legal liabilities arising from the release of commodity information in violation of the Rules shall be on the account of the merchants and have nothing to do with JD.HK Open Platform. JD.HK Open Platform is entitled to delete any product information that violates the Rules immediately and reserves the right to punish the merchant until the cooperation is terminated.

4.2.2.1  Description of product release elements:

1)   Commodity title

The attributes of the commodity can be simply and clearly stated in the commodity title, with descriptive words. However, it is not allowed to abuse the brand name and words irrelevant to the commodity.

2)   Commodity picture

As clear and beautiful pictures play an important role in promoting transactions, all commodities are required to be displayed with pictures. The picture specifications are 980*250 pixels for Banner pictures, 180*60 for Logo pictures, and 700 pixels for commodity description pictures, with a resolution of 72 pixels.

3)   Commodity description

Commodity description is to show buyers the characteristics and attributes of commodities. Detailed commodity description plays a vital role in the success of selling commodities.

Commodity description should explain commodity attributes such as appearance, color, size, composition, content, quality, packaging, warranty, shelf life, origin, function, and use, which will help buyers to understand commodity attributes more comprehensively. Any exaggerated description, false description, and links to other websites to replace descriptions used to attract buyers are invalid.

4)   Commodity price

Market price refers to the reference price of goods sold in the offline market; and the price on JD.HK Open Platform refers to the actual selling price of commodities on JD.HK Open Platform.

5)   Commodity quantity

Commodity quantity is divided into the stock keeping unit (SKU) quantity and SKU inventory quantity. The number of commodities on sale in the store shall not be less than 60, and the SKU inventory quantity shall not be 0.Note:

The stock keeping unit (SKU) quantity refers to the quantity of product models in the same brand, which can not be less than 60.

SKU inventory quantity refers to the inventory quantity of a single model product, which can not be 0.

6)   Commodity category

The categories of all commodities sold in the store must be consistent with the system of JD.HK Open Platform.

4.2.2.2  Other rules for commodity release:

1)   JD.HK Open Platform has the right to prohibit merchants from releasing commodity information that violates the relevant regulations of JD.HK Open Platform. For details, please refer to the Prohibited Commodities and Information Management Standard of JD.HK Open Platform.

2)   All commodities released by merchants on JD.HK Open Platform must comply with relevant laws and regulations.

3)  The merchant must release the commodities on JD.HK Open Platform according to the "Business Scope" agreed in the Contract signed between the merchant and JD.HK Open Platform.

4)   Merchants are not allowed to release fake, refurbished, unauthorized, used, second-hand commodities and other commodity information that violates the "guarantee of authenticity".

5)   Without formal written authorization (no power of attorney within the specified period), the commodity information of the merchant shall not contain any brand logo and relevant information that may infringe.

6)   Merchants are not allowed to release advertising information related to wholesale, investment promotion, agency, advertisement, poster, etc. in the store.

7)   Merchants are not allowed to release commodities that are inconsistent with the description of commodities, have no actual commodities, and only provide the contact information of the publisher and non-commodity information.

8)    Merchants are not allowed to publish link information in stores to induce buyers to transact on other websites.

9)   Merchants are not allowed to include the physical store address, contact information, contact person, and other information in the commodity pictures, commodity descriptions, commodity titles, and other information of the commodities being sold in the stores.

10) The commodity attribute must be consistent with the commodity category or attribute selected for the released commodity.

11) The pictures of commodities displayed in the store must include the original pictures and photos of physical objects, and the pictures of non-original physical objects after deliberate processing and modification shall not be used.

12)       Identical commodities or commodities with identical important attributes can only be released once.

13)       Merchants must improve and provide the pictures and text description information of the commodities sold in the store.
